The PDMM-20 is a low-impedance multimeter with an auto-ranging for easy voltage and resistance measurements. The non-contact voltage detection function identifies live lines, and for added safety, the end-user is freed from having to switch any dials and introduce the risk of selecting the wrong function.

Dupont Tyvek HomeWrap

www.construction.tyvek.com Siding — whether vinyl, wood, stucco, brick, or composite — does not completely prevent air and water penetration. Tyvek HomeWrap is a secondary defense to help manage a home's wall systems by serving as a protective layer under siding and over the sheathing. Pass & Seymour/Legrand

New in the TradeMaster line are two new tamper-resistant ground fault circuit interrupter receptacles, one with a built-in hallway light that uses a high-output LED for better illumination and longer life. Tamper-resistance features include a UL-listed and automatic mechanical shutter system that prevents objects from being inserted into the receptacle.

Saicis

Tico Taco is a porcelain tile with the HI-TECH Gres characteristics of unglazed, multiple-loaded porcelain with rectified and polished options. This tile can be used for both residential and commercial environments. Tico Taco offers a shimmering stone look that's complete with a variety of colors, sizes, mosaics and decorative pieces.
